How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Douglasville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Douglasville Studio Apartments | $1,448 | $899 | $2,249 |
Douglasville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,490 | $919 | $2,814 |
Douglasville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,726 | $1,045 | $3,058 |
Douglasville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,107 | $1,433 | $4,108 |
Douglasville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,715 | $1,631 | $1,799 |

Getting Around Douglasville, GA
Walk Score®
33 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
25 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
1 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
